The Factors Influencing Rates

Electricity pricing is influenced by a myriad of factors that can vary significantly from one region to another. One of the primary determinants is the cost of generating electricity, which can fluctuate based on the type of energy sources used, such as coal, natural gas, nuclear power, or renewables like solar and wind. The availability and price of these resources directly impact how much consumers pay. Additionally, seasonal demand plays a critical role; for instance, during peak summer months when air conditioning use surges, prices may increase due to higher demand.

Another important factor is transmission and distribution costs. These expenses arise from the infrastructure required to deliver electricity from power plants to homes and businesses. Maintenance and upgrades to this infrastructure can lead to changes in rates as utilities pass on these costs to consumers. Moreover, regulatory policies and market structures established by government entities can also affect pricing dynamics. Understanding these elements is vital for consumers who want to manage their energy expenses effectively.

Variable vs. Fixed Rates

Consumers often encounter two primary types of electricity pricing: variable and fixed rates. Fixed-rate plans provide stability by locking in a specific rate for a predetermined period, typically ranging from six months to several years. This option can be particularly advantageous during periods of rising prices, as it protects consumers from fluctuations in the market. However, if market prices drop significantly, those locked into fixed rates might miss out on potential savings.

On the other hand, variable-rate plans are tied directly to market conditions and can change monthly based on supply and demand dynamics. While they may offer lower initial rates, they come with the risk of sudden increases that could strain household budgets. Consumers should carefully assess their energy usage patterns and financial situations when choosing between these options to find the best fit for their needs.

Regional Differences in Pricing

Electricity rates are not uniform across regions; they can vary widely due to several local factors. Geographic location plays a significant role in determining energy prices. For instance, areas with abundant renewable energy resources may benefit from lower rates due to cheaper generation costs associated with solar or wind power. In contrast, regions dependent on fossil fuels may face higher prices as global oil and gas markets fluctuate.

Additionally, state regulations and utility company structures can lead to substantial differences in pricing models. Some states have deregulated electricity markets where consumers have the freedom to choose their energy suppliers, potentially leading to competitive pricing options. Conversely, regulated markets often have set tariffs that limit competition but provide more predictable pricing structures.

The Role of Renewable Energy

Impact on Pricing Structures

The transition toward renewable energy sources has profound implications for electricity pricing structures across various markets. As more utilities incorporate solar panels and wind turbines into their energy mix, consumers may start seeing changes in their bills reflecting these shifts toward cleaner alternatives. Renewables often have lower operational costs once established since sunlight and wind are free resources; however, initial capital investment remains high.

Furthermore, as technology improves and becomes more efficient at harnessing renewable energy, we may witness a gradual decrease in overall generation costs over time. This trend could translate into lower consumer prices as utilities pass on savings derived from renewable investments. However, it’s essential for stakeholders to remain aware that transitioning too rapidly without adequate infrastructure support can lead to instability in supply and potential price spikes during peak demand times.

Government Incentives

Government policies play an essential role in shaping the landscape of renewable energy adoption and its subsequent effect on electricity pricing. Incentives such as tax credits for solar panel installations or subsidies for wind farm development encourage both individuals and companies to invest in green technologies. These measures not only promote sustainability but also help stabilize or even reduce electricity costs over time.

Additionally, regulatory frameworks aimed at reducing carbon emissions often require utilities to diversify their energy portfolios by integrating more renewables into their operations. Such mandates can spur innovation within the industry but may also result in short-term rate increases as companies invest heavily in new technologies before realizing long-term benefits through reduced operational costs.

Consumer Participation

As awareness about climate change grows among consumers, many are actively seeking ways to participate in sustainable practices related to their electricity consumption. Programs such as community solar initiatives allow individuals who cannot install solar panels on their properties—like renters or those with shaded roofs—to still benefit from renewable energy production.

Moreover, consumers are increasingly becoming proactive about managing their own energy consumption through smart technology solutions like smart thermostats or home energy management systems (HEMS). These tools enable users to monitor real-time usage data and adjust consumption patterns accordingly—potentially leading them toward lower bills while promoting overall grid efficiency.

Emerging Technologies

The future landscape of electricity pricing is likely shaped significantly by emerging technologies that revolutionize how power is generated and consumed. Innovations like battery storage systems promise greater flexibility within grids by allowing excess renewable energy generated during peak production times—such as sunny afternoons—to be stored for later use during high-demand periods at night.

Additionally, advancements in artificial intelligence (AI) analytics enable utilities to predict demand trends more accurately while optimizing supply chain management processes efficiently—this predictive capability allows them not only better resource allocation but also improved customer service experiences through tailored offerings based on individual usage patterns.

As these technologies become more prevalent over time—and if regulations encourage widespread adoption—we could see transformative shifts regarding both price stability and consumer empowerment within electricity markets moving forward.
